Enterprise App Development in 2025: A Guide for CTOs
Enterprise App Development in 2025: A Guide for CTOs
The digital era we live in is disrupting enterprise app development and fundamentally changing how businesses operate. The International Data Corporation (IDC) estimates that the global enterprise application market is increasing steadily in value and is expected to reach USD $400 Billion by 2025. This remarkable growth is propelled by the need for automation and elaborate digital transformation frameworks.
Advanced enterprise app development solutions offer much more than basic features. Users in different departments no longer have to perform repetitive tasks like filling forms and entering data because these powerful applications automate those processes and capture information from different sources. These developments improve operational efficiency in all departments.
In this guide, we will look at how enterprise web applications are expected to change by 2025, including indispensable features, and the development approach that guarantees successful deployment.
Defining Factors Enterprise App Development is 2025 Uniqued From Previous Years.
Enterprise app development is undergoing profound changes in 2025 due to the critically distinct factors driving shifts.
Shifting user demands and business requirements
Now, businesses are looking for enterprise applications that do more than simply provide basic functions. Modern employees expect enterprise applications to provide effortless interaction. Employees expect enterprise apps to be user-friendly and accessible on all devices. Mobile devices are extensively used within the enterprise environment and access to enterprise apps on mobile devices leads to greater employee satisfaction. Employees accessing mobile devices have 25 percent greater satisfaction when mobile device interfaces are designed responsively and intuitively.
The emergence of AI and automation in business tools
AI is no longer a new technology, as it now exists as a feature of modern business applications. Intelligent automation incorporates robotic process automation, AI, machine learning, and business process management, resulting in the automation of entire business processes.
There are expectations for considerable growth by 2025 in:
- Agentic AI capable of performing functions while humans still oversee tasks.
- Automation of seamless system and employee interplay.
- Enhanced workflow efficiency using AI augmentation in orchestration.
The effect is significant – AI is anticipated to add $1324.77 Trillion to the world economy by 2030 Comprising nearly total process automation through hyperautomation, 70 percent of apps will be built utilizing low-code/no-code platforms by 2025.
Increased Emphasis on Security and Compliance
Mobile App Security Development Life Cycle (MASDSLC) has gained pivotal importance in security and enterprise application development. Outdated security paradigms are becoming obsolete as zero-trust cybersecurity models where no user or device is considered trustworthy by default become the norm.
Indeed, companies that are AI-governed will mitigate 40% of ethical AI issues by 2028 which would have otherwise happened without any such systems in place. In addition, strong encryption, sophisticated authentication, and privacy-protecting technology are rapidly becoming standard features in business applications.
With the changing pace of regulatory frameworks like HIPAA and GDPR, compliance needs to be built within the architecture of the enterprise applications as modules rather than being baked in after-the-fact.
Key Benefits of Enterprise Web Applications for Modern Businesses
Business of all scales are reaping the rewards of implementing enterprise web applications and experiencing benefits like optimized operational performance alongside greater financial results.
Enhancing Internal Productivity and Automation
Like cloud-based systems for enterprise resource planning, enterprise web applications eradicate repetitive monotonous tasks. They also simplify complex workflows which drastically increases efficiency in various departments. The systems consistently reduce the paperwork manual processes generate and human error that comes along with it—enhancing overall productivity. As an illustration, businesses that have adopted workflow automation systems report a 45% increase in speed of processes. This allows employees to focus on high-thinking tasks rather than get bogged down in repetitive processes.
Enterprise app development solutions allow businesses to manage operations from one interface. This optimizes resource allocation because now every task completes electronically through systems and between teams which improves productivity while minimizing manual processes.
Enhancing cross-team collaboration
Enterprise applications allow for easier sharing and access of documents and other resources making it useful in breaking down departmental silos. Industry studies show that online collaboration tools improve fostered understanding and communication by up to 30%. This productivity surge is also captured through cross business units.
Enterprise applications create a central location enabling staff to access similar information, documents, along with project management tools. By having shared access, transfer of knowledge is enhanced, learning across organizations is accelerated, and the company’s sense of community and unified shared purpose is improved.
Increased Emphasis on Security and Compliance
Modern enterprise applications change the way information is viewed for strategic decision making. These systems provide various forms of analytics nowadays which enables management to:
- Identify Emerging trends and market opportunities.
- Spot operational inefficiencies before they affect performance.
- Make informed decisions based on actual information rather than assumptions
- Make decisions based on accurate and current data
Responding to improving conditions makes shifting towards data driven approaches enables maintaining a competitive advantage difficult to deal with.
2025 Enterprise App Development Requirements
For successful enterprise app development in 2025, it is crucial to integrate emerging features aligned with shifting business needs and technological potential. The following elements are integral to the development of enterprise applications to ensure they are useful and provide significant value.
Real-time coordination tools
As employees work more and more from different locations, having real-time collaboration features has evolved from useful to essential. Documents must allow automatic co-authoring of edits as well as version history tracking. Apart from document editing, good collaboration tools must also provide for:
- Teamwork across company boundaries which fosters communication across organizational silos
- 35 or more instant multi-language translation capabilities
- Cognitive portable tools which allow teams to plan, think creatively and collaborate regardless of their physical location.
Pattern recognition systems which detect shifts in customer behavior Predictive models of market and business conditions Outcome forecasting of business Interactive visual aids for better understanding of complex information for top level management
AI Onboarding Workflows
AI system powered tools can scan large datasets for patterns and deliver insights. This indicates that enterprise applications have fundamentally undergone a shift on how they work, ranging from customer support to equipment maintenance.
Cloud Architecture for computers, smartphones, tablets and smartwatches
Monolithic structures are the more complex form, however, they utilize single all-encompassing microservices. Interdependent stand to denote counterpart functions cloud applications work together to improve modularity.
Third Modules of Integrational Power and Application Logic
Centralized API management systems overlook maintenance while syncing data across multiple applications. Real-time data synchronization enables information to be updated promptly, and businesses operate more efficiently. Applications and other enterprise systems can communicate with one another.
Creating comprehensive solutions for industry-specific applications takes time and proper planning, which include: identifying goals, developing an outline and establishing an end product users can easily interact with. The following includes all five steps to help in formulating the strategies needed for optimal growth outcomes needed within the enterprise plan.
1. Project scoping and requirement gathering
Firstly capturing an enterprise’s application development begins with understanding the organization’s exact requirements. At this stage, collaboration with stakeholders is critical to collecting pertinent information as to what the application is meant to achieve and its primary functional goals.
2. Choosing the right tech stack and architecture
Then after the tech stack becomes vital for your enterprise app development service. With the growing needs of your organization there are several considerations that go into choosing a project type, scalability, team’s expertise, maintenance requirements and development costs.
3. Frontend and backend development
During this phase of app development, the specific features and functionalities of the application will be programmed by the developers. On modern approaches, coding is avoided in favor of using low-code or no-code platforms for faster development. Branding and usability are fundamental to the interfaces therefore, user friendly interfaces are designed during front end development. Smooth integration to the already existing systems in the business is ensured by backend development.
4. Testing and quality assurance
Testing is an essential focus with enterprise applications and as such, extensive testing is certainly required. This includes:
* Functional testing to verify requirements compliance
* Integration testing to ensure seamless component interaction
* Performance testing to assess responsiveness under various conditions
The enterprise applications undergo testing with the aim of identifying and dealing with defects to ensure quality standards are met and reliable performance is achieved in enterprise environments.
Final thoughts
Development for enterprise-grade applications continues to improve at a staggering rate, redefining how organizations function in an increasing digitally reliant world. In this guide, we analyzed the lasting changes transforming and expected to transform the enterprise application environment in 2025 and later.
Certainly, the attention toward easy user interaction, automation using AI, and enhanced security indicates a change in corporate attitude to enterprise systems. Due to the capabilities of modern analytics, modern applications now assist in collaborative cross-functional decision-making rather than merely serving as data repositories.